Output 4a5a9bfcfdbae98a3e7d6c80500648deaebd2e5ce7f66c87b56098bf9adafaf0:1

value
28295960
script pubkey
OP_0 OP_PUSHBYTES_32 2d5e7da72801ce4bd53209d2c8418cb0db2004cacf8a464424cdd941bb574f8e
address
bc1q9408mfegq88yh4fjp8fvssvvkrdjqpx2e79yv3pyehv5rw6hf78qdv8flu
transaction
4a5a9bfcfdbae98a3e7d6c80500648deaebd2e5ce7f66c87b56098bf9adafaf0
confirmations
139894
spent
true